Output 10bfda5bca28efef3d314b984bbcf6751ce79e16cf5bc5945b3b3195a5fbfb63:53

value
2816215
script pubkey
OP_0 OP_PUSHBYTES_20 87bf8023f38390d8246b2a4d279b483a3db3db53
address
bc1qs7lcqglnswgdsfrt9fxj0x6g8g7m8k6nfptv8s
transaction
10bfda5bca28efef3d314b984bbcf6751ce79e16cf5bc5945b3b3195a5fbfb63
confirmations
184274
spent
true